Compare commits
4 Commits
e1dc79c0dd
...
3fc08a1e84
Author | SHA1 | Date |
---|---|---|
Derrick Hammer | 3fc08a1e84 | |
Derrick Hammer | 31cabc6c0a | |
Derrick Hammer | 4e0021ef23 | |
Derrick Hammer | 312f8ab43a |
|
@ -28,8 +28,11 @@ function testIndexedDBSupport() {
|
|||
|
||||
request.onerror = function (event) {
|
||||
// Error occurred, reject the promise
|
||||
// @ts-ignore
|
||||
reject(new Error("IndexedDB test error: " + event?.target?.errorCode));
|
||||
|
||||
reject(
|
||||
// @ts-ignore
|
||||
new Error("IndexedDB test error: " + event?.target?.error?.code),
|
||||
);
|
||||
};
|
||||
|
||||
request.onsuccess = function (event) {
|
||||
|
@ -55,8 +58,11 @@ function testIndexedDBSupport() {
|
|||
export async function boot() {
|
||||
let userKey;
|
||||
|
||||
if (!(await testIndexedDBSupport())) {
|
||||
try {
|
||||
await testIndexedDBSupport();
|
||||
} catch {
|
||||
setKernelLoaded("indexeddb_error");
|
||||
sendAuthUpdate();
|
||||
logErr("indexed db is not supported or is blocked");
|
||||
return;
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ue